What About Alaskan Cruises

Cruises are a good way to spend a holiday. The meals and entertainment are included in the cost of the trip and the on-board cooks create offerings mouth-watering enough for any palate. Cruises can be taken to many destinations, but a popular favorite are Alaskan cruises. These cruises feature some of the loveliest views found in North America and provides an experience unlike any other.

Finding the sweetest deals on Alaskan cruises takes a small amount of time and a little bit of research before purchasing a cabin. By following some useful guidance, passengers can save up to fifty percent on the total cost of their cruise. When considering that the price of Alaskan cruises are typically around $1000 per person, this adds up to significant savings and that money can be spent on other items such as souvenirs and shore excursions.

Tip One – Book Early

The 1st tip for getting the sweetest deals on Alaskan cruises is to order your cabin early. Many of the cabins that are the best value, such as standard cabins with balconies, sell out quickly leaving the less desirable rooms for the late comers. Booking early can also ensure that your cabin is closer to the entertainment venues, pools, and restaurants, as many cruise ships are very large and individuals with cabins towards the bottom and ends of the ship can find themselves with quite a long hike to get to the food and entertainment on board.

Tip Two – Compare Prices

The second tip for getting the top deal on Alaskan cruises is to compare prices. There are quite a few cruise companies that conduct Alaskan cruises on a regular basis. The costs for these cruises alter by company and cruise liner thanks to the conveniences available on each ship, the ports the cruise liner pulls into, and the length of the cruise. Because of these differences, cruises can differ in price by several hundred dollars easily.

The price of the Alaskan cruises can also differ between booking companies. The price you will pay for booking the cruise through the cruise company can be cheaper or more expensive than booking the same cruise through a travel agent or discounted travel website. When you define which Alaskan cruises you have got an interest in, get price quotes for each cruise from a few difference sources to establish which source solidly has the most competitive prices.

Tip Three – Last Minute Deals

If you have got the capability to travel on short notice, you might be able to find a deal on booking Alaskan cruises during the week or 2 before the ship sets sail. In many cases, the cabins have not all been booked prior to the sailing date and the cruise companies would rather book these cabins at a deeply discounted rate rather than let them remain empty for the voyage. There are categorical web sites online devoted to last minute travel deals where you’ll be able to find these terribly discounted rates for Alaskan cruises, as these rates are usually not offered by the cruise company. In many cases, these discounted prices can be 50% less than the going rate for booking the cabin.
